GREAT BAY, St. Maarten ( Thursday, May 17, 2012)-Art of Living St. Maarten and St. Maarten AIDS Foundation are teaming up to mark the 29 anniversary of the world’s largest annual community-based AIDS event ‘Candle lighting memorial’ and to bring to St. Maarten the biggest multicultural peace event on Sunday, May 20.
The event which will be held at the A.C Wathey Cruise and Cargo Facility starts at 6:00pm with the Candle lighting memorial which leads into ‘I Meditate SXM’ a large scale cultural event with the theme ‘Celebrating Humanity’. The meditational aspects of the event will be led by Founder of the Arts of Living Foundation Sri Sri Ravi Shankar, a world renowned humanitarian leader, spiritual teacher and ambassador of peace. His vision of a stress-free, violence-free society has united millions of people the world over through service projects and the courses of The Art of Living. Sri Sri will lead the meditational aspect of ‘I meditate SXM’ via live feed from an ashram Germany. Guest Speakers will include Prime Minister Sarah Wescot Williams and Minister of Health Cornelius De Weever.

PHILIPSBURG, Sint Maarten (Thursday, May 17, 2012)– The Central Committee of Parliament will meet in a public session on May 21 to discuss correspondence from the Corporate Governance Council (CGC), Financial Supervision and the Parliament of Latin America Parlatino.
The meeting will take place on Tuesday afternoon at 2.00 pm in the General Assembly Chamber of the House of Parliament at Wilhelmina Straat #2.1 in Philipsburg.

GREAT BAY, St. Martin (Thursday, May 17, 2012) – Parliament will debate and possibly vote on the Emancipation Day legislation seeking to make July 1st, Emancipation Day, a national public holiday when it meets at 10:00AM on Monday, May 21st in a plenary session convened by the President of Parliament, drs. Gracita Arrindell.
